How they compare
Palestine currently reports 25.6% against 25.3% in Paraguay, a difference of 0.3%.
The two have swapped places 6 times across 32 shared years of data; in 1994 it was Palestine ahead.
Paraguay ranks 73rd and Palestine ranks 71st of 187 countries.
Palestine has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Paraguay | Palestine |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 21.8% | 37.9% | 16.1% | Palestine |
| 2000s | 19.9% | 24.5% | 4.6% | Palestine |
| 2010s | 22.1% | 23.4% | 1.3% | Palestine |
| 2020s | 23.4% | 25.1% | 1.7% | Palestine |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Gross capital formation includes acquisitions less disposals of produced assets for purposes of fixed capital formation, inventories or valuables. This indicator is expressed as a percentage of Gross Domestic Product (GDP) which is the total income earned through the production of goods and services in an economic territory during an accounting period.
